Aussies Abroad: Stellar Performances in European Qualifiers and Transfers Galore!
Aussie footballers continue to make their mark abroad in this week's transfer window updates. Jordan Bos has joined his boyhood favourite club, Feyenoord, for a fee of 5 million Euros. Massimo Luongo has signed with Millwall for one year after training with the club, following his Ipswich contract expiration. In more exciting news, Aussie right-back James Overy has penned a professional contract with Manchester United and celebrated with a commendable under-21 match appearance. Meanwhile, Matildas midfielder Alex Chidiac makes a move to Como in Italy. There are also plenty of star performances in Europa Conference League qualifiers and much, much more from across the globe!
